A devotional reminder from TAN Books to pause and pray the Angelus at 6 AM, 12 PM, and 6 PM daily.
Restore a beautiful Catholic tradition to your daily routine. This free extension from TAN Books gently reminds you to pause and pray the Angelus at the three traditional hours: 6:00 AM, 12:00 PM, and 6:00 PM. For centuries, church bells have rung at these times to call the faithful to meditate on the Incarnation of Our Lord. Now, wherever your work takes you online, a quiet notification will invite you to step away, lift your heart to Heaven, and pray the Angelus with the universal Church.
